%T Consciousness: An afterthought
%X Our sense that we do something deliberately may be an
afterthought that arises after our brains have already triggered our action
unconsciously. Consciousness itself may be a similar illusory afterthought,
with no direct causal role. In any case, Methodological epiphenomenalism,
together with the Turing Test, seem to be be the best strategy for cognitive
modelling.
